From c174dbc5354c8442ae67e3020ba361441ec9123f Mon Sep 17 00:00:00 2001 From: Waldemar Brodkorb Date: Fri, 17 Feb 2012 15:31:08 +0100 Subject: choose kernel for toolchain only builds --- Config.in | 9 +++++++++ mk/kernel-ver.mk | 5 +++++ target/x86/sys-available/toolchain-i686 | 9 +++++++++ target/x86/sys-available/toolchain-x86 | 9 --------- 4 files changed, 23 insertions(+), 9 deletions(-) create mode 100644 target/x86/sys-available/toolchain-i686 delete mode 100644 target/x86/sys-available/toolchain-x86 diff --git a/Config.in b/Config.in index 52593ebe9..d8d403109 100644 --- a/Config.in +++ b/Config.in @@ -89,6 +89,15 @@ source "package/Config.in.auto.global" source "package/Config.in.auto" endmenu +choice +prompt "Kernel Version" +config ADK_KERNEL_VERSION_TOOLCHAIN + prompt "2.6.39.4" + boolean + depends on ADK_TOOLCHAIN_ONLY + +endchoice + menu "Kernel configuration" depends on !ADK_TOOLCHAIN_ONLY && !ADK_CHOOSE_TARGET_ARCH && !ADK_CHOOSE_TARGET_KERNEL && !ADK_CHOOSE_TARGET_SYSTEM && ADK_TARGET_KERNEL_CUSTOMISING diff --git a/mk/kernel-ver.mk b/mk/kernel-ver.mk index e2f65f330..2d7f6b34e 100644 --- a/mk/kernel-ver.mk +++ b/mk/kernel-ver.mk @@ -1,3 +1,8 @@ +ifeq ($(ADK_KERNEL_VERSION_TOOLCHAIN),y) +KERNEL_VERSION:= 2.6.39.4 +KERNEL_RELEASE:= 1 +KERNEL_MD5SUM:= a17c748c2070168f1e784e9605ca043d +endif ifeq ($(ADK_KERNEL_VERSION_2_6_39_4),y) KERNEL_VERSION:= 2.6.39.4 KERNEL_RELEASE:= 1 diff --git a/target/x86/sys-available/toolchain-i686 b/target/x86/sys-available/toolchain-i686 new file mode 100644 index 000000000..e4c02a0e5 --- /dev/null +++ b/target/x86/sys-available/toolchain-i686 @@ -0,0 +1,9 @@ +config ADK_TARGET_SYSTEM_TOOLCHAIN_X86 + bool "Toolchain only" + select ADK_x86 + select ADK_toolchain_x86 + select ADK_CPU_I686 + select ADK_TOOLCHAIN + help + Build a x86 toolchain (i686 optimized). + diff --git a/target/x86/sys-available/toolchain-x86 b/target/x86/sys-available/toolchain-x86 deleted file mode 100644 index e4c02a0e5..000000000 --- a/target/x86/sys-available/toolchain-x86 +++ /dev/null @@ -1,9 +0,0 @@ -config ADK_TARGET_SYSTEM_TOOLCHAIN_X86 - bool "Toolchain only" - select ADK_x86 - select ADK_toolchain_x86 - select ADK_CPU_I686 - select ADK_TOOLCHAIN - help - Build a x86 toolchain (i686 optimized). - -- cgit v1.2.3